The phrase "Pacific Rim MKV" sits at a unique intersection of cinematic sci-fi lore and digital video technology. To a movie enthusiast, it represents the colossal Jaeger robots and Kaiju monsters of Guillermo del Toro’s 2013 blockbuster film. To a home theater tech buff, it represents the Matroska Video (MKV) container file used to store high-definition, multi-track copies of that visual masterpiece.
